Javascript 以角度转换阵列对象

Javascript 以角度转换阵列对象,javascript,angular,typescript,Javascript,Angular,Typescript,需要转换下面给出的数组对象 [{ key:"url", value:"new" },{ key:"page", value:1 }] // after (need to convert like this) { url:"new", page:1 } // before 您可以使用: 常量数组=[]; Object.entries{url:new,page:1}.forEach[key,value]=>{ a

需要转换下面给出的数组对象

[{ key:"url", value:"new" },{ key:"page", value:1 }]  // after (need to convert like this)
{ url:"new", page:1 }  // before
您可以使用:

常量数组=[]; Object.entries{url:new,page:1}.forEach[key,value]=>{ array.push{key,value} }
console.logarrayPlease,在询问之前做一些研究。所有对象的结构是否如图所示?跟after对象一样?顺便说一句,这不是一个真正的角度问题。我想要转换,反之亦然{url:new,page:1}需要转换如下[{key:url,value:new},{key:page,value:1}]这是代码示例的目的。请在此处查看它的实际操作: